How far is Lafayette, LA from Bastrop, LA?

The driving distance from Lafayette, LA to Bastrop, LA is about 205.9 miles (331.3 km), with a travel time of about 03h 52m by car.

  • The straight-line flight distance is about 176.6 miles (284.2 km).
  • For a round trip, plan for roughly 07h 45m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.

How long does it take to drive from Lafayette to Bastrop?

The road trip is about 205.9 miles (331.3 km) and usually takes 03h 52m in normal driving conditions.

Is this a same-day trip or an overnight route?

This is still possible in one day, but it becomes a long driving day. Leaving early and planning your stop window matters more here.

What is the halfway point on this route?

Pollock is a useful midpoint, sitting about 103.1 miles from Lafayette and 102.8 miles from Bastrop.

How much longer is the road route than the straight-line distance?

The direct path is about 176.6 miles (284.2 km), while the road route adds roughly 29.3 extra miles because roads do not follow the straight air line.
